Tomahawks, Tomahawks, Tomahawks. That’s the word buzzing in the ears of Russian President Vladimir Putin, as President Donald Trump weighs providing…
Platinum is heading for a third consecutive annual deficit in 2025, with the World Platinum Investment Council (WPIC) projecting an…